
Toni Jeffries
Toni Jeffries is a retired British professional boxer who gained fame as a bronze medalist in the light heavyweight category at the 2008 Beijing Olympics. After transitioning to professional boxing in 2009, he achieved a record of 9 wins and 1 draw before retiring in 2012 due to chronic hand injuries. Following his boxing career, Jeffries moved to the United States, where he established himself as a popular boxing trainer and YouTube content creator, amassing over 2.69 million subscribers by March 2025. He recently made headlines by setting a Guinness World Record for the most punches thrown in 24 hours, accomplishing this feat on his 40th birthday to inspire his three daughters.
